Abbottstown, PA
Region: Dutch Country Roads
Abbottstown was founded in 1753 by John Abbott. The town features the historic Altland House, built-in 1790, which offers several rooms for reservation as well as fine dining in the Altland House Restaurant, which the oldest restaurant in Abbottstown.
